Rapid Measurement
Batch Measurements of Transmission Test Items
Example for PDC/PHS, only about 1 second is
required to measure all major transmission test items,
including frequency, modulation accuracy, origin off-
set, transmission rate, transmission power, leakage
power during carrier-off, rise/fall edge characteristics,
occupied bandwidth, and adjacent channel power.
Pass/fail decisions for limit value of each test item can
also be displayed.
Measurement of Antenna Power
Rise/Fall Edge Characteristics
Antenna power rise/fall edge characteristics can be
measured simultaneously with antenna power mea-
surements. In addition, the marker points can be
moved and the power can be read directly with 1/10
symbol resolution.
Calibration Functions
A built-in thermocouple power sensor is used for cali-
bration, providing accurate measurement of absolute
values such as average power with burst signal and
leakage power during carrier-off. There is no need for
other instruments; Just one press of the CAL key dur-
ing measurement performs calibration.
Modulation Analysis
The user can display the waveform as either frequency
deviation, eye diagram or constellation diagram to
easily show any irregularities in the modulation.
Constellation Display Functions
The I/Q vector components of measured signals are
displayed. The frequency error, RMS/PEAK vector
errors, and origin offset can be shown on the same
screen.
